August 14, 201015 yr I would like to post my log in order to provide information on Level 1 compatibility for a motherboard. The problem is that I can't seem to find my log. I looked in tower\flash\logs, but it only goes to a certain date, which I assume is the day I installed Unmenu. When I go to Unmenu, it only provides the log for today. (I did reboot today.) How do I find the log for yesterday.
August 14, 201015 yr Since you rebooted, I do not believe that you can recover the syslog from prior to the reboot unless you had copied it to another location (flash or array). From my understanding, each reboot rebuilds most of the environment to include the /var/log location where syslog resides. Unless it is already incorporated, I'll probably be looking into how to set up copying the syslog to a "perm" location as part of the shutdown/reboot process Still learning as I go.
August 27, 201015 yr Correct, your log is wiped clean on every reboot. Sorry to say you'll have to go through the Level 1 testing again. Your efforts to get your motherboard tested are greatly appreciated, though.
